Planning and Leading a Social Justice Event
This event will be planned and led by the entire confirmation class.
I. The first step is to figure out what our motivation is for doing social justice.
What bible stories inform our desires to do justice?
What world events or issues make us feel like we want to do something?
What does our faith community teach us about issues of justice?
II. Decide on a particular justice issue you want to address
III. Find out what is already being done in our community to address this issue.
IV. Contact the organizations already working on this issue and find out where there are gaps.
V. Interview someone experiencing this issue to see what support would be most helpful
VI. Decide on the type of event you would like to plan. ie: fundraiser, materials drive, informational meeting, etc.
VII. Set a date and an agenda for the event
VIII. Publicize and plan the event
IX. Lead the event
X. Discuss what went well, what you might do differently next time, and what you learned by doing this. Document your discussion so others can benefit from your learning.
